What Makes Windermere FL Luxury Real Estate Different

Windermere is a small town of roughly 3,500 residents inside the town limits, surrounded by a broader 34786 zip code that encompasses much of the surrounding lake country. What sets it apart from neighboring luxury markets like Dr. Phillips or Winter Park is geography. Windermere sits on a peninsula of land threaded with lakes, which means a remarkable share of homes here have direct water frontage, private docks, or deeded boating access.

The town's land-use rules have also preserved a low-density, almost rural feel. You won't find high-rise condos or dense townhome developments. Instead, you'll see brick streets, mature oak canopies, and estate homes set on half-acre to multi-acre lots. For luxury buyers prioritizing privacy, water access, and long-term value, Windermere is consistently one of the strongest markets in Central Florida.

Price points reflect that. While the broader Orlando metro median sits around $410,000, Windermere's luxury homes routinely list from $1.5 million to $20 million-plus, with Butler Chain frontage commanding the highest premiums.

The Butler Chain of Lakes: Windermere's Crown Jewel

The Butler Chain of Lakes is a connected system of 13 spring-fed lakes — including Lake Butler, Lake Down, Lake Tibet-Butler, Lake Sheen, and Lake Louise — that together form one of the cleanest and most navigable lake systems in Florida. The chain is designated an Outstanding Florida Water by the state, which means strict protections on water quality, shoreline development, and motorized use.

For homeowners, this designation translates into something rare: a private, navigable freshwater playground that's protected for generations. You can launch a boat from your own dock, ski across Lake Tibet-Butler in the morning, dock at the Isleworth Country Club for lunch, and watch the Magic Kingdom fireworks from your own waterfront in the evening. That combination of recreation, privacy, and proximity to Orlando's attractions is virtually impossible to replicate elsewhere in Central Florida.

Properties with direct Butler Chain frontage carry a meaningful premium over comparable interior lots — often 30% to 60% more, depending on the specific lake, lot width, and dock rights. Buyers should also factor in the long-term value: Butler Chain frontage has historically appreciated faster than the surrounding luxury market because new lakefront inventory simply can't be created.

Inside Windermere's Most Sought-After Communities

The Windermere luxury market is anchored by several distinct communities, each with its own character and price profile.

Isleworth is the most well-known — a private, guard-gated golf community on Lake Tibet-Butler with a Tom Fazio-designed course, a private marina, and a roster of high-profile homeowners. Estates here typically range from $3 million to $15 million-plus, with chain-frontage properties commanding the top of the market.

Keene's Pointe offers a similar lifestyle on Lake Tibet-Butler with a Jack Nicklaus Signature golf course and a tight-knit community feel. Homes range from roughly $1.2 million to $6 million, making it one of the more accessible luxury entry points in Windermere.

Old Windermere — the historic town center — offers character-rich homes on brick streets, often on Lake Butler or Lake Down. These properties appeal to buyers who prioritize charm, walkability to the town's small shops, and direct chain access.

Lake Butler Sound and Reserve at Lake Butler Sound are gated estate communities with custom homes on oversized lots, many with Butler Chain access via canal or community dock.

What Luxury Buyers Need to Know Before Making an Offer

Buying a Windermere luxury home — especially one on the Butler Chain of Lakes — is not a transaction to rush. The due diligence required goes well beyond a standard home inspection. Lakefront properties involve seawall and dock condition, riparian rights, shoreline setbacks, boathouse permitting, and lake-specific HOA rules. A small issue with a dock permit or seawall can cost tens of thousands to remediate, and not every inspector is qualified to evaluate these elements.

The Windermere luxury market also moves on relationships and timing. Some of the most desirable estate properties — particularly on Lake Butler and Lake Tibet-Butler — change hands quietly before they ever hit the MLS. Working with an agent who knows the local owners, builders, and dockmasters opens doors that public listings never will.

Financing is another consideration. Many Windermere luxury transactions are cash or jumbo loans, and appraisals on unique lakefront properties can be tricky. Sellers expect proof of funds with an offer, and buyers without a strong, local lender often lose out in competitive situations.

Selling a Windermere Luxury Home: What Owners Should Expect

The luxury market plays by different rules than the broader Central Florida market. While the wider Orlando metro is seeing longer days on market and more price negotiation, Windermere lakefront homes — particularly turnkey properties on the Butler Chain — continue to attract serious, qualified buyers from across the country and internationally.

That said, presentation matters more than ever. Drone photography capturing the lake, the dock, and the boundary of your property is non-negotiable. Twilight photography of the home and lakefront frequently doubles online engagement. Staging should highlight outdoor living spaces — covered docks, summer kitchens, pool decks, and screened lanais — because that's what differentiates Windermere from other luxury markets.

Pricing strategy is also nuanced. The Windermere luxury market doesn't have the comp density of a tract neighborhood, so each property needs its own custom valuation that weighs lake frontage, dock rights, lot size, recent improvements, and community amenities. A misplaced list price can mean months on the market and a six-figure price cut. A precise one can mean multiple offers within the first two weeks.
